Nanshan half marathon postponed to Dec. 18
    2022-12-07  08:53    Shenzhen Daily

Han Ximin


1824295095@qq.com


THE 2022 Nanshan Half Marathon was rescheduled to be held Dec. 18, according to the announcement from one of the organizers, China Resources, on Tuesday evening.


The race’s route will form a T shape symbolizing technology and will start from the east gate of Shenzhen Talent Park and go southward along Shahe West and Wanghai roads. It will then turn northward at Shenzhen Bay Park’s Sunrise Opera House, passing Shahe West Road and Shennan Boulevard. The finish line will be at Shenzhen Bay Sports Center, according to the organizer.


Runners who have registered can apply to quit before 6 p.m. tomorrow due to the delay, which was originally planned to be held Dec. 4. Individual runners who choose not to participate this year will have their spots reserved for the event in 2023. However, group runners who cancel won’t have their spots reserved for the 2023 event.


The half marathon is estimated to have 16,000 participants, including 12,700 individual runners and 3,000 runners from 100 running clubs. The remaining 300 slots in the quota are allotted to 10 charity running clubs.


The organizer reminded runners to take personal precaution and it will update its COVID-19 prevention and control requirements according to the latest situation. Participants can collect their bibs between Dec. 15 and 17 at Shenzhen Bay Sports Center in Nanshan District.


In another development, the website doyouhike.net, operated by Shenzhen Zaitu Science and Technology Co. Ltd., announced on its official WeChat account Monday that it will organize the 22nd Shenzhen 100KM hiking event in Guangming on Saturday and Sunday. In the last two years, hikers fondly called the event Guangming 100-kilometer hiking since it started and ended at Guangming sports center. The number of participants is limited to 900 people this year, and the organizer only accepts group hikers.
